If you listen to the Guardian's Football Weekly podcast from yesterday Sid Lowe comments in some detail on this Canales contract situation.

The essential thrust is that his father/advisors are just sounding out other clubs at the moment and that he is fully expected to re-sign with Racing Santander BUT that there will be a very substantial release clause in his contract that is being inserted to ensure that when (rather than if) he goes, the club gets suitable recompense.

The view of his family/advisors is that he is currently too young to go to a massive club but they were thinking that 12-18 months down the line that they would be moving him on.

Bad news was the fact that they fully anticipated that they would go to Real Madrid.
